Salary overview

The median wage here is $35,380 a year, within a few percent of the national median of $32,910. Half of workers earn between $35,190 and $41,120. Beyond that band, the tenth percentile sits at $35,190 and the ninetieth at $45,690.

The area has 50 jobs in this occupation, which works out to 0.5 of every thousand jobs. Seattle leads the state's metro areas for this occupation, at $44,250. Set against every other occupation measured in the same area, it ranks 309th of 309 by median pay.

What the pay is worth locally

Prices in Bremerton run 7.0% above the national average, so the median of $35,380 buys what $33,065 would elsewhere in the country. Measured that way the gap against the national median narrows to 0.5% above the national median in real terms.
